What Is Premises Liability?
Premises liability is grounded in the concept that home owners and occupiers have a responsibility to make sure that their premises are safe for visitors. This includes all kinds of residential or commercial properties, such as property homes, business buildings, [Insurance Claim Lawyer](https://md.entropia.de/M-L_RvB6QxCM3l1F04BUfA/) and public areas. If somebody is hurt due to hazardous conditions on a property, the victim might have premises to file a claim against the homeowner, offered they can prove that the owner was negligent in resolving recognized threats.

To establish an effective premises liability claim, the complainant must usually prove the list below components:
Duty of Care: The homeowner had a legal task to keep a safe environment.Breach of Duty: The residential or commercial property owner stopped working to meet that responsibility by enabling unsafe conditions to exist or by failing to take suitable action to remedy them.Causation: The complainant's injury was directly brought on by the risky condition on the residential or commercial property.Damages: The plaintiff suffered actual damages due to the [Accident Injury Attorney](https://timeoftheworld.date), including medical expenditures, lost incomes, and discomfort and suffering.The Role of a Premises Liability Lawyer

What does "duty of care" imply in premises liability?
The task of care describes the legal obligation of residential or commercial property owners to guarantee their premises are safe for visitors. This responsibility differs based upon the visitor's status (invitee, licensee, or trespasser).
2. Who can make a premises liability claim?
Anyone who is injured on someone else's home due to risky conditions might can sue, including visitors, clients, and even workers in particular scenarios.
3. What is the time limit for filing a premises liability claim?
The statute of constraints for premises liability cases varies by state. It is frequently in between one to six years, depending upon jurisdiction. It's important to consult a lawyer promptly after an incident to avoid missing out on any due dates.
4. What damages can I claim in a premises liability case?
Victims may recover various damages, consisting of medical costs, lost earnings, pain and suffering, and, in many cases, punitive damages if the homeowner acted with gross negligence.
